| Abstract | Political changes, exchange rate risk and globalization of the markets along-with
regionalization of the trading economies are forcing multinational corporations (MNCs)
allover the world to have a global presence. This not only reduces costs, but also provides
better customer feed-back and diversifies the risks/exposures of the MN Cs
Polytex Corporation Ltd., a chemical manufacturing company, based in U.S.A. chose
Thailand for ventming into Asian markets, especially South East Asia. Once the decision
to come to Thailand was made, the problem was to identify a suitable site within
Thailand which will be ideal for Polytex's operations.
This report identifies the factors affecting the site location decision, both quantitative and
qualitative and compares sites based on these factors using the Brown & Gibson method. |
